Transaction 93176efebcf9cc5083d458a2e33b4949e68482fbbd83b827840db11cd9905144
1 Input
2 Outputs
- 93176efebcf9cc5083d458a2e33b4949e68482fbbd83b827840db11cd9905144:0
- 93176efebcf9cc5083d458a2e33b4949e68482fbbd83b827840db11cd9905144:1
value 22325452
address 1FWGeUCGAxP3po8eJNRRTDg5pxj1Y4m3oz
value 5090687
address 113WRk4nqusN1yCK96tXk7u14k9cDNZFya